Remember - you need an AN8002 as well 
The AN8008 has gaps in the current ranges, and as a result, it doesn't measure low milliamps very well. It's the cost of including a uA range, and using the 10A shunt to measure milliamps - made possible by the very good voltage sensitivity of the IC. Personally, I'd rather they'd dropped the square wave generator and included a separate mA range using a 1 ohm shunt or similar, but it is what it is. The AN8002 doesn't do microamps, but does milliamps perfectly. And on those occasions when you need 2 multimeters to monitor 2 things in a circuit, it's nice that they're different colours.
